Mom’s Mental Health in Pregnancy Could Affect That of Her Child – HealthDay

Posted: Published on November 18th, 2023

FRIDAY, Nov. 17, 2023 (HealthDay News) -- A pregnant woman's mental health might have profound effects on the mind of her unborn child, a new evidence review warns. Children appear to be at higher risk for mental health and behavior issues if their moms were highly stressed, anxious or depressed during pregnancy, researchers report Continue reading

Vision Impairment Associated with Developing Mental Health … – MD Magazine

Posted: Published on November 18th, 2023

The prevalence of mental health conditions was highest among patients with retinal vein occlusion and age-related macular degeneration (AMD) compared to other ocular conditions.1 The study, led by Neha Sharma, BA, MPH, from Case Western Reserve University School of Medicine in Cleveland, sought to identify the prevalence of mental health conditions in patients with uveitis, glaucoma, retinal vein occlusion, AMD, and diabetic retinopathy with or without vision impairment. Findings were presented at the 127th Annual American Academy of Ophthalmology (AAO) conference in San Francisco. About 2.2 billion people have vision impairmentand that number is projected to grow.
